Frank Burr Mallory (November 12, 1862 ā September 27, 1941) was an American pathologist at the Boston City Hospital and Professor of Pathology at Harvard Medical School, after whom the Mallory body is named.[2]

The Pathology Department at Boston City Hospital, the Mallory Institute of Pathology, was named after him.[1]
